I don't think he's talking about logging on to the network. Often times universities have unsecured networks that any and all devices can connect to--but in order to have ANY data transfer, you have to login using your ID and password from the school. If you try to visit a web page before logging in, your are redirected to the login page immediately.

erraticarsonist, have you tried opening the browser? Sounds like a silly question, but I feel like something would pop up there (especially if you use Firefox and set your location to a be recognized as a desktop browser). If not, that app that NiceGuysFinishLast is talking about should do the trick, though I can't remember what it's called either.
 
At my school, you just have to open the browser once you connect to the network and it prompts you for a username and password.
